Monday's WWE Raw Rating Plummets Again to 15 Year Low


Monday's WWE Raw again plummeted, scoring only a 2.48 cable rating coming weeks after the disastrous Oct. 1, 2012 show, which garnered a 2.54 in comparison. This week's rating is the worst Raw rating for a non-holiday episode since October 27, 1997 (scoring a 2.3 rating).

Viewership averaged 3.55 million viewers which is down on last week's 3.98 million viewers. The first hour drew 3.57 million viewers, the second hour drew 3.65 million viewers and the third hour drew 3.43 million viewers.

To put viewership into some context, the final hour drew 3,432,000 -- which is the lowest third hour since they made the switch the three hour format. Hour one (3,578,000) and two (3,653,000) are the second lowest hours respectively since 10/1.
